Abstract

The present invention provides a closing structure which closes, with an igniter, an opening of a cylindrical housing used in a gas generator, the cylindrical housing provided with a stepped surface formed on an inner side of a circumferential wall on the side of the opening, and a distal end circumferential wall extending from the stepped surface to the opening, the igniter having an igniter main body, and an igniter collar surrounding part of the igniter main body and having an annular plate portion with a maximum outer diameter and a circumferential wall excluding the annular plate portion, the annular plate portion including, a first annular surface facing the ignition portion of the igniter main body, a second annular surface facing the electroconductive pin of the igniter main body, and an annular circumferential surface between the first annular surface and the second annular surface, a first annular circumferential edge at the boundary between the first annular surface and the annular circumferential surface, and a second annular circumferential edge at the boundary between the second annular surface and the annular circumferential surface, and the second annular circumferential edge provided with an inclined surface in three or more locations, and the first annular surface of the igniter collar being abutted against the stepped surface of the cylindrical housing, and the annular circumferential surface and the second annular circumferential edge of the igniter collar being abutted against the distal end circumferential wall.
